SLP responsibilities:
- Evaluate residents for speech, language, cognition, and swallowing disorders
- Develop and implement individualized treatment plans
- Provide therapeutic interventions that promote safety, communication, and independence
- Document progress and outcomes according to regulatory and facility guidelines
- Educate residents, families, and staff on strategies for improved function and safety
- Collaborate with other therapy and healthcare staff to ensure coordinated care
